Description
Out-of-bounds read for some Intel(R) PROSet/Wireless WiFi Software for Windows within Ring 0: Kernel may allow a denial of service. Unprivileged software adversary with an unauthenticated user combined with a high complexity attack may enable denial of service. This result may potentially occur via adjacent access when attack requirements are present without special internal knowledge and requires no user interaction. The potential vulnerability may impact the confidentiality (none), integrity (none) and availability (high) of the vulnerable system, resulting in subsequent system confidentiality (none), integrity (none) and availability (high) impacts.

Impact

An out‑of‑bounds read flaw in the Intel PROSet/Wireless WiFi Software for Windows can allow kernel mode code to read unintended memory, potentially leading to a crash of the operating system. The CVE entry indicates that the exploit may be triggered without user interaction and requires an unprivileged and unauthenticated attacker. The described impact is limited to availability, with no effect on confidentiality or integrity.

Affected Systems

The vulnerability affects Intel PROSet/Wireless WiFi Software for Windows. No specific version numbers are provided in the advisory, so the vulnerability may exist in any release of the product that contains the affected code. Systems running this software should therefore verify whether they are running a version that contains the fix.
